But observers believe that North Korean weapons would only give a short-term boost to Moscow’s war effort. They say Moscow, with hugely depleted ammunition, is relying on older, more unreliable artillery shell stocks. North Korea’s arms could act “as a stop-gap measure” while Russia struggles to ramp up production, noted Mr Akimenko.
